Post by: humble on November 26, 2006, 10:17:04 AM
There are alot of good squads out there. Normally you'll run into them just as a matter of normal game play. If you pull up the roster on the clipboard you can use it to list players by squad. Alot of times squads are operating on both the local vox and a squad vox channel so you may or may not here alot of chatter.

Ask whats going on and lend a hand....most squads will let you tag along with no problem.
